Dripping Dishwasher


This is probably the most day-to-day dish washer issue, and also the bright side is that it is very easy to recognize. Leakages take place as a result of a number of reasons, and the leakages can bungle your kitchen. Usual sources of dishwashing machine leaks include;

 

  • Improper pipeline connection: If the pipelines at the back of your equipment are not safely fixed or if they are worn, it can create leaks.

  • Inappropriate dish piling: Always make certain that you do not overstack the tray and that you set up the recipes correctly

  • Excessive cleaning agent: Putting sufficient cleaning agent can additionally cause a leak. Guarantee that you place simply sufficient for your recipes and also not extra.

  • Rust: It could also be a result of some rust or corrosion of your machine. In this case, it is better to change the dish washer.

  • Door Seals: Examine if the door seals are still undamaged as well as safely fastened. If the seals are not ready, maybe a considerable root cause of leaks.

Bad-Smelling Dish washer


This is an additional common dish washer problem, as well as it is mainly triggered by food particles or oil lingering in the device. In this case, seek these particles, take them out as well as do the recipes without any meals inside the device. Wash the filter completely. That will assist get rid of the negative smell. Make sure that you get rid of every food particle from your meals prior to moving it to the machine in the future.

 

Failure to Drain pipes


Sometimes you may observe a huge quantity of water left in your bathtub after a clean. That is probably a drainage problem. You can either inspect the drain hose pipe for damages or obstructions. When unsure, get in touch with an expert to have it inspected and fixed.

 

Does not clean properly


If your dishes and also flatwares come out of the dishwasher and also still look filthy or unclean, your spray arms may be a trouble. In a lot of cases, the spray arms can get clogged, and also it will call for a fast clean or a substitute to work efficiently once more.

Dishwasher Won’t Drain? 8 Steps to Fix It

 

Run the Disposal

 

A full garbage disposal or an air gap in a connecting hose can prevent water from properly draining out of the dishwasher. Simply running the disposal for about 30 seconds may fix the issue.

 

Check for Blockages

 

Check the bottom of the dishwasher to make sure that an item or pieces of food haven't fallen from the rack to block the water flow.

 

Load the Dishwasher Correctly

 

Make sure you’re loading the dishwasher correctly. Read the manufacturers’ instructions or owner’s manual for tips and directions on how to load dishes for best results.

 

Clean or Change the Filter

 

You may have a clogged dishwasher filter that’s preventing water from draining. Many homeowners don’t realize that dishwasher filters need to be cleaned regularly. Check your owner’s manual to see where the filter is located on your dishwasher, and for instructions on how and when to clean it. For many dishwashers, the filter can be found on the inside bottom of the appliance.

 

Inspect the Drain Hose

 

Check the drain hose connecting to the sink and garbage disposal. Straighten any kinks that you may see, which could be causing the problem. Blow through the hose or poke a wire hanger through to check for clogs. Make sure the hose seal is tight, too.

 

Try Vinegar and Baking Soda

 

Mix together about one cup each of baking soda and vinegar and pour the mixture into the standing water at the bottom of the dishwasher. Leave for about 20 minutes. If the water is draining or starting to drain at that time, rinse with hot water and then run the dishwasher’s rinse cycle. That may be enough to help loosen any clogs or debris that are preventing the dishwasher from draining properly.

 

Listen to Your Machine While It's Running

 

Listen to your dishwasher while it’s running a cycle. If it doesn’t make the usual operating sounds, particularly if it’s making a humming or clicking noise, the drain pump and motor may need replacing. If this occurs, it may be time to call a professional for help.
